My L3830 can bush hog all day in 95 degree heat and never go above 4 bars. The only time it goes to 5 or more bars is when the radiator screen is clogged, which happens regularly. When I see 5 bars, I stop and clean the radiator screen and all the air intakes into the engine compartment and let the tractor idle until it goes back to 4 bars. I don't blow out the radiator with compressed air until I'm through for the day and back to the barn.

I learned the hard way that when I ignore the increasing number of bars I will soon have a red light and a warning buzz.

When you get way on up there, it'll start showing "Overheated" on the display and a warning will sound. At least that's what happens on my L4740.

Personally, I've noticed that mine can go for 3 to 4 hours before it starts getting hot and at my ripe old age, that's about time for a break anyway. After letting it cool down I use water to clean out the radiator and the rest of the stuff in there. The a/c works better too when it's clean. There's just a lot of stuff packed in there that needs a bunch of air passing over it in order to keep it cool.

For me, air simply does not get the stuff out...gotta use water hose, just normal pressure, not pressure washer. Problem occurs only when going thru 3 ft plus weeds, shredding, lots of chaff. Amazing amount of stuff comes out. I leave tractor running when washing out when hot. Temp falls very fast back to normal range, stays there.
